Hadlow War Memorial
1694/3/10018
II

War memorial. Circa 1920. Lifesize stone statue of soldier in social realist style in uniform, including puttees, cap and bag, standing at ease resting on gun and supported on rock to rear with base inscribed "To our Glorious Dead 1914-1919". This stands on a stone plinth about four feet in height inscribed with the names of the fallen from the Great War and a tablet on the ground bears a list of names from the Second World War within a square stone enclosure.
